The Uttarakhand Board Results 2026 was declared on 25th April after that the state’s Education Department has adopted a strict accountability framework targeting underperforming teachers in government and aided schools. In a major shift from previous years’ leniency, authorities have decided to issue adverse ‘Red Entry’ remarks in the service records of teachers whose students fail to meet expected academic benchmarks.

This move comes amid growing concerns over declining performance in plain districts and falling trust in government-run schools.

What is ‘Red Entry’ and Why Does It Matters?

A ‘Red Entry’ is a serious negative remark recorded in a government employee’s service book. It can directly impact:

  • Promotions
  • Salary increments
  • Career progression

The Uttarakhand Education Department has now made it clear that poor academic results will no longer go unchecked. Dr. Mukul Kumar Sati, Director of Secondary Education, confirmed that the process has already begun, stating that action against underperforming teachers will soon be visible on the ground.

Subject-Wise Evaluation: New Accountability Framework

In a significant reform, the department has moved beyond overall school performance and introduced subject-wise teacher evaluation.

Key Highlights of the New Rule:

  • Below State Average: Teachers whose subject results fall below the state average will receive a Red Entry.
  • Individual Accountability: Each teacher will be assessed based on their subject performance.
  • Collective Action: Schools with high failure rates will see action taken against the entire teaching staff.

This ensures that responsibility is clearly defined and measurable, reducing the chances of accountability gaps.

UK Board Result 2026 District Rankings: Hills vs Plains Divide

The 2026 results have revealed a surprising outcome, hilly districts outperforming resource-rich plain areas.

Top Performing Districts (Hilly Regions)

  • Bageshwar: Secured the top rank in both Class 10 and 12 with an impressive 94.81% pass rate in Intermediate exams.
  • Pithoragarh: Ranked 2nd in both board classes.
  • Rudraprayag: Achieved 3rd position in Class 10 and 4th in Class 12.

Despite facing challenges like teacher shortages and lack of infrastructure, these districts delivered exceptional results.

Worst Performing Districts (Plain Regions)

  • Dehradun: Ranked 13th (last) in Class 10 and 12th in Class 12, despite having the best resources and teacher availability.
  • Haridwar: Stood 12th in Class 10 and 13th (last) in Class 12, with a pass percentage of just 75.45%.

This stark contrast has raised serious questions about teaching quality and accountability in urban government schools.

Why Are Government Schools Losing Trust?

Education experts believe that declining performance is directly linked to:

  • Reduced accountability among teaching staff
  • Preference for private schools among parents
  • Lack of consistent performance monitoring
  • The introduction of the Red Entry system is being seen as a corrective measure to restore discipline and improve outcomes.

The Uttarakhand Board Results 2026 have not only highlighted regional disparities but also triggered a major policy shift in teacher accountability. With the implementation of the ‘Red Entry’ rule, the state is signaling zero tolerance for poor academic performance. If executed effectively, this reform could mark a turning point in improving the quality of education across Uttarakhand’s government schools.
